CVE-2023-37286 pertains to SmartSoft SmartBPM.NET's vulnerability using hard-coded machine keys, enabling remote attackers to execute arbitrary code and disrupt services. Learn about the impact, affected systems, and mitigation steps.
SmartSoft SmartBPM.NET has a vulnerability that involves the use of hard-coded machine keys, which can be exploited by an unauthenticated remote attacker. This allows the attacker to send serialized payloads to the server, leading to the execution of arbitrary code and potential service disruption.
Understanding CVE-2023-37286
This section provides insights into the nature of the CVE-2023-37286 vulnerability.
What is CVE-2023-37286?
CVE-2023-37286 pertains to a vulnerability in SmartSoft SmartBPM.NET where hard-coded machine keys are utilized, allowing remote attackers to execute malicious code by sending serialized payloads.
The Impact of CVE-2023-37286
The impact of this vulnerability is critical, with a CVSS base score of 9.8 (Critical). It poses a high risk to confidentiality, integrity, and availability of affected systems, potentially leading to service disruptions.
Technical Details of CVE-2023-37286
This section delves into the technical aspects of the CVE-2023-37286 vulnerability.
Vulnerability Description
The vulnerability involves the utilization of hard-coded machine keys in SmartSoft SmartBPM.NET, enabling remote attackers to send serialized payloads and execute arbitrary code on the server.
Affected Systems and Versions
Vendor: SmartSoft Product: SmartBPM.NET Affected Version: 6.70
Exploitation Mechanism
An unauthenticated remote attacker can exploit the hard-coded machine key vulnerability by sending serialized payloads, leveraging it to execute arbitrary code on the server.
Mitigation and Prevention
This section outlines the necessary steps to mitigate and prevent the exploitation of CVE-2023-37286.
Immediate Steps to Take
Users are advised to contact SmartSoft for guidance on addressing the hard-coded machine key vulnerability in SmartBPM.NET.
Long-Term Security Practices
Implementing secure coding practices, regular security audits, and ensuring sensitive information is not hard-coded can help prevent similar vulnerabilities in the future.
Patching and Updates
Stay informed about security updates and patches released by SmartSoft to address the CVE-2023-37286 vulnerability.